Tutorial Menggunakan Sensor Fingerprint Arduino


Kembali lagi di blog ini, sekarang saya akan memposting sebuah tutorial tentang membaca sidik jari dengan sensor fingerprint. Ya sensor fingerprint ini merupakan sensor yang digunakan untuk membaca sidik jari manusia. Sejauh ini yang saya tau bentuk sidik jari setiap manusia berbeda – beda tapi tidak menutup kemungkina ada saja yang sama, bahkan jaman sekarang sidik jari juga digunakan dalam pembuatan E-KTP meskipun E-KTP punya saya belum jadi dari jaman megalitikum sampai sekarang wkwk. Baik tanpa panjang cerita langsung aja ke komponen yang diperlukan seperti gambar dibawah

Langkah kerja untuk memulai mengambil data sidik jari atau enroll dengan sensor fingerprint adalah sebagai berikut
  1. Upload program blank pada arduino yang digunakan kalian bisa pilih board jenis apa aja pada saat ini kalian jangan melakukan wiring ke sensor fingerprintnya, karena klo kalian sudah melakukan wiring akan terjadi error uploading karena pin TX RX akan terganggu komunikasinya (jika pake board arduino)
  2. Melakukan wiring seperti gambar diatas, sebenernya kalian bisa juga mengganti arduinonya dengan hanya memakai USB to Serial dengan wiring yang sama, berhubung USB to serial punya saya ngumpet tidak ketemu maka saya pake saja metode dengan arduino ini wkwkwk
  3. Setelah itu kalian buka aplikasi SFG Demo, nah di aplikasi inilah kita akan menampilkan pembacaan sidik jari dan akan menyimpannya ke alamat addres yang ada di sensor fingerprintnya. Jika kalian belum punya bisa donlot disini
  4. Setelah itu klik tombol open device, dan kalian sesuaikan dengan port serial yang terbaca di komputer kalian. Jika berhasil akan muncul tulisan “Open Device Succes” warna biru dibagian atas aplikasi. Jika gagal coba cek wiringnya mungkin kebalik TX RX nya soalnya saya sering sekali kaya gitu. Baurate komunikasinya set 57600
  5. Centang 2 kali priview pada menu enroll dan dibawahnya
  6. Jika Sudah kalian klik con enroll fungsinya untuk melakukan penyimpanan data sidik jari secara berkelanjutan, kalian bisa pilih enroll untuk menyimpan sidik jari di addres tertentu
  7. Setelah itu kalian disuruh memasukan addres untuk penyimpanan data sidik jari kalian, stelah itu klik OK
  8. Nah after that diatas aplikasi akan muncul “please put your finger on sensor” kalian langsung saja tempelkan sidik jari yangmau diambil datanya
  9. Jika sudah berhasil di bagian atas akan muncul “succes to get finger, transfering....” disini berarti data sidik jari kalian berhasil terbaca dan beberapa saat kemudian bentuk sidik jari kalian akan terlihar di aplikasinya
  10. Secara otomatis data sidik jari yang kalian tempelkan akan tersimpan di addres yang kalian buat di awal tadi, mantap bukan....
  11. Kalo kalian mau mengambil data sidik jari yang lain kalian tinggal tempelkan saja sidik jari yang lainnya, secara otomatis akan tersimpan di addres selanjutnya pada sensor finger prin. Hal ini dikarenakan kita memilih con enroll seperti yang saya jelaskan di step no 6
  12. Dan kalian bisa melakukan penyimpanan data sesuai kebutuhan kalian dengan cara yang sama
  13. Data sidik jari inilah yang kalian nanti gunakan sebagai data yang akan kalian gunakan untuk membuat suatu aplikasi misalnya security sistem dll


Setelah kalian berhasil menyimpan beberapa data sidik jari pada sensor fingerprint tentu kalian harus mengetesnya bukan?, karena kalo tidak di tes diawal kalian akan mengalami keruwetan secara berkelanjutannya wkwkwk, berikut step yang kalian dapat gunakan untuk mengetes apakan data yang tadi sudah tersimpan dan dapat terbaca
  1. Masih dalam kondisi wiring yang sama dan aplikasi SFG Demo yang masih terbuka
  2. Klik “cancle operate” jika masih dalam mode perekaman data sidik jari, tapi untuk memastikan klik aja “cancel operate” dua kali 
  3. Pada bagian tengan aplikasi ada menu match, didalam menu match ini ada tombol “search” klik tombol “search”
  4. Maka dibagian atas muncul tulisan “please put your finger” yang artinya kalian disuruh untuk menempelkan jari kalian seperti cara yang pertama
  5. Jika berhasil maka akan muncul pesan “succes to get image, transfering....” berarti data sidik jari kalian sudah terbaca dan tunggu beberapa saat maka muncul tulisan “find same finger ! ID=0” nah berarti data sidik jari yang kalian masukan sudah match dengan sidik jari yang terdaftar diawal tadi, ID = 0 itu merupakan alamat addres penyimpanan data sidik jarinya
  6. Sekarang coba kalian tempelkan sidik jari yang lainnya yang tidak terdaftar/ coba suruh teman kalian tempelkan jari mereka di sensor fingerprint ini
  7. Maka untuk sidik jari yang tidak terdaftar akan muncul pesan “Not find same finger!” yang artinya data sidik jarinya tidak ada kesamaan dengan data yang tersimpan di fingerprint
  8. Setelah itu kalian tinggal melakukan improvisasi saja untuk step selanjutnya wkwkwk

Nah kalo yang masih bingung dengan penjelasan yang panjang lebar saya diatas, karena memang kata – katanya aneh dan asing kalian bisa menengok tutorialnya di video berikut, oiya di video ini saya juga melakukan pembacaan sidik jari dengan metode lain yaitu dengan program arduino download programnya disini 






Komentar

Posting Komentar